The cheapest way to get from Northern Liberties to Citizens Bank Park is to subway which costs $3 and takes 33 min.
The fastest way to get from Northern Liberties to Citizens Bank Park is to taxi which takes 9 min and costs $15 - $19.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from 8th St & Brown St and arriving at 8th St & Oregon Av. Services depart every 15 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 25 min.
Yes, there is a direct train departing from Fairmount and arriving at NRG Station station. Services depart every 15 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 19 min.
The distance between Northern Liberties and Citizens Bank Park is 5 miles.
The best way to get from Northern Liberties to Citizens Bank Park without a car is to subway which takes 33 min and costs $3.
The subway from Fairmount to NRG Station takes 19 min including transfers and departs every 15 minutes.
